Q: Who has been the most consistent scorer in Grizzlies vs Spurs matchups lately?
A: Jaren Jackson Jr. stands out—he regularly delivers high-scoring performances, while Ja Morant steps up when healthy.
Q: How impactful has Victor Wembanyama been when active?
A: Very impactful. He regularly records big numbers in points, rebounds, and blocks, though injuries have limited his overall influence.
Q: Any surprise breakout performances from bench players?
A: Definitely. Cam Spencer and Jaylen Wells have delivered key scoring bursts off the bench in several tight games.
Q: Do rebounding stats often translate to wins for Memphis?
A: Not always. Memphis has had rebounding advantages—like the 59–38 dominance—but still lost such games due to execution issues.
Q: What game moments are most memorable?
A: Hard to forget Morant’s post-whistle dunk over Wembanyama, or those final-minute heroics like Spencer and Fox delivering winning buckets.
